Abstract :
This paper tries to analyze a new framework of lossless information hiding research. Its key is how to get adaptively better difference image architectures for given applications. A unique sampled pattern is introduced and described in term of high-similar interpolation image. Seeking the higher peak value in the difference-image is also our concerns. As a whole algorithm, histogram-difference-expanded based structures are reported. Simulations results demonstrate and verify that our new approach is much effective than the nearest difference expansion method with good generalization performance.
